The American Express tournament has become a staple on the PGA Tour calendar, offering an early-year showcase of golfing talent. As players compete across three stunning courses in California’s Coachella Valley, the tournament promises thrilling moments and world-class performances. Cable TV Channels

The American Express is typically broadcast live on popular sports channels such as Golf Channel and CBS Sports. These networks provide comprehensive coverage, including live play, analysis, interviews, and behind-the-scenes insights. Here’s what you need to know:

  1. Golf Channel
    • Coverage Times: Early rounds and some morning sessions.
    • Available on: Major cable providers like Comcast, DirecTV, and Dish Network.
  2. CBS Sports
    • Coverage Times: Weekend rounds and final-day action.
    • Highlights: In-depth commentary and exclusive interviews with players.

Live Streaming Options

For cord-cutters or fans on the go, you can also catch The American Express on popular streaming platforms. Services like ESPN+, Peacock, and Paramount+ often offer live streams of golf tournaments, including The American Express.

  1. ESPN+: Exclusive early-round streams and featured groups coverage.
  2. Peacock: Comprehensive streaming of NBC and Golf Channel broadcasts.
  3. Paramount+: Includes CBS Sports coverage for subscribers.
